About Mars, Incorporated

Mars is a family-owned business with more than a century of history making diverse products and offering services for people and the pets people love. With almost $35 billion in sales, the company is a global business that produces some of the world’s best-loved brands: M&M’s®, SNICKERS®, TWIX®, MILKY WAY®, DOVE®, PEDIGREE®, ROYAL CANIN®, WHISKAS®, EXTRA®, ORBIT®, 5™, SKITTLES®, UNCLE BEN’S®, MARS DRINKS and COCOAVIA®. Mars also provides veterinary health services that include BANFIELD® Pet Hospitals, Blue Pearl®, VCA® and Pet Partners™. Headquartered in McLean, VA, Mars operates in more than 80 countries. The Mars Five Principles – Quality, Responsibility, Mutuality, Efficiency and Freedom – inspire its more than 100,000 Associates to create value for all its partners and deliver growth they are proud of every day.

Purpose of Role

The role is leading the strategy execution and supply chain management of innovative comanufacturing activities for Mars Petcare NA. The role is critical in supporting our external manufacturing supply chain in order to support MPCNA growth and innovation agenda, ensuring flawless execution of co-manufacturing activities through future innovation. This role will also focus on driving value creation and security of supply for Mars. The role operates in a pet friendly, open office environment supporting natural pet nutrition and making the world a better place for Pets.

Principal Accountabilities

  • Support innovation agenda through identifying potential solutions to growth initiatives by partnering closely with Marketing and our IE teams.
  • Support supplier cost saving and continuous improvement initiatives within the US, to ensure consistent delivery of value creation.
  • Work collaboratively with the Supply and Quality & Food Safety teams to maintain excellent service and quality levels from our suppliers.
  • Identifying continuous improvement opportunities to deliver savings back to business & challenge current processes deliver a more efficient supply-chain.
  • Work closely and collaboratively on the day-to-day issue management with the Supply and Quality & Food Safety teams. The job holder needs to influence development of these activities and identify continuous improvement opportunities to deliver savings back to business.
  • Help source new coman/copack providers that can help drive current and future innovation pipelines.
